Pack of Brazil Mod - Civ4 civis plus 4 new ones

The file is: http://www.civfanatics.net/downloads...packs/PoBM.zip




Pack of Brazil Mod (PoBM) adds in your game Brazil and three more civis that have relationship with the formation of this nation: Tupi, Portugal and Zulu (represents the Bantu of Angola and Mozambique). It has static LHs and the UUs uses texture work only, I expect change it in the future.

enjoy


01- Brazil

Title and leader 1: Imperador Pedro II
Leader 1 bonuses: Organized and Creative
Leader 1 favourite civic: Representation
Unique Unit: Pracinha (Infantry, 2+ power)

Title and leader 2: Presidente Vargas
Leader 2 bonuses: Philosophical and Industrious
Leader 2 favourite civic: Police State


02- Tupi

Title and leader: Cacique Cunhambebe
Leader bonuses: Aggresive and Expansive
Leader favourite civic: Tribalism
Unique Unit: Tamoio (Scout, 1+ moviment per turn)


03- Portugal

Title and leader: Infante Henrique
Leader bonuses: Philosophical and Financial
Leader favourite civic: Hereditary Rule
Unique Unit: Carrack (Caravel, 1+ moviment per turn)


04- Zulu

Title and leader: chief Shaka
Leader bonuses: Philosophical and Industrious
Leader favourite civic: Tribalism
Unique Unit: Impi (Warrior, 1+ moviment per turn)
